… Cal @Washington …
The Huskies …
… mauled …
… the Bears 41-17 at Husky Stadium, leaving Cal at 0-5 in the Pac-12 and 1-7 on the season …
… once again, the Bears were doomed by a slow start, as they fell behind 17-0 before getting on the scoreboard themselves …
… thus continuing a season-long pattern of first quarter struggles.
Although the defense showed signs of improvement, big plays once again plagued the Bears …
… with the Huskies scoring on a 59 yard run and passes of 68 and 47 yards …
… and also completing non-scoring passes for 25, 21 and 21 yards …
… while HB Bishop Sankey had 241 yards rushing on 27 carries, averaging 8.9 yards per carry and scoring 2 touchdowns.
Washington finished the game with 642 yards in total offense and averaged 8.2 yards per play from scrimmage, while recording 24 first downs …
… to 483 yards (5.5 per play) and 21 first downs for the Bears.

There were a few Cal highlights …
… HB Khalfani Muhammad busted a 73 yard TD run, the longest of the season for the Bears ….
… QB Jared Goff was 32 of 54 for 336 yards passing, with 1 TD …
… WR Bryce Treggs had 8 receptions for 95 yards, with a long of 32 yards …
… and WR Chris Harper had 6 catches for 98 yards, including a 5 yard TD and a long of 49 yards.
